MARTHASVILLE ELEM. is a Title I public elementary school that is part of the WASHINGTON school district, located in MARTHASVILLE, MO with about 212 students offering grade levels from Kindergarten to 6th Grade. A Title I school provides supplemental financial assistance to school districts for children from low-income families. Its purpose is to provide all children significant opportunity to receive a fair, equitable, and high-quality education. With about 18 teachers, MARTHASVILLE ELEM. has a student/teacher ratio of about 11:1. The national average for public schools is about 15:1. A lower student/teacher ratio is a key factor that determines how much a teacher can devote his/her time to each individual student thus improving, or reducing (in the event of a higher student/teacher ratio) the attention each student is given for their educational needs.

School Demographics for 212 students

The primary ethnicity of students attending MARTHASVILLE ELEM. is predominantly White, representing about 94% of the student body.
